Abstract
We fabricated transparent Copper Sulphide (CuS) thin film with good electrical conductivity, copper sulphate was deposited on hot glass substrate. This film then converted to CuS by treating with H2S at different temperature. The film's material properties are characterized using XRD and FE-SEM. Optical and electrical properties were studied using electrometer and UV-Vis spectrophotometer. The sheet resistance ∼60 ß/cm2 was observed with a transparency of 63% for the CuS films that are treated at 360°C. Also, the current voltage characteristic data of these transparent conducting films showed a good photo response.
